*************************************************************************** Canon SELPHY ES series print assister (c) 2007-2012 Solomon Peachy The latest version of this program can be found at http://git.shaftnet.org/git/gitweb.cgi?p=selphy_print.git *************************************************************************** The SELPHY ES-series printers from Canon requires intelligent buffering of the raw print data in order to keep the printer from locking up. Known supported & tested printers: SELPHY ES1, ES2, ES30 Supported but untested: SELPHY ES20, ES3 SELPHY CP10, CP100, CP200, CP220, CP300, CP330, CP400, CP500, CP510, CP520, CP530, CP600, CP710, CP720, CP730, CP740, CP750, CP760, CP770, CP780 NOT currently supported: SELPHY ES40, CP-790 I need the readback codes for these printers in order to proceed. SELPHY CP-810, CP-900 Currently unknown stream format (and possibly unknown readback codes) *************************************************************************** Selphy ES1: Init func: 40 00 [typeA] [pgcode] 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 Plane func: 40 01 [typeB] [plane] [length, 32-bit LE] 00 00 00 00 TypeA codes are 0x10 for Color papers, 0x20 for B&W papers. TypeB codes are 0x01 for Color papers, 0x02 for B&W papers. Plane codes are 0x01, 0x03, 0x07 for Y, M, and C, respectively. B&W Jobs have a single plane code of 0x01. 'P' papers pgcode of 0x11 and a plane length of 2227456 bytes 'CP_L' pgcode of 0x12 and a plane length of 1601600 bytes. 'Card' pgcode of 0x13 and a plane length of 698880 bytes. P* sizes are 100x148mm "postcards" CP_L sizes are 89x119mm "labels" Card sizes are 54x86mm "cards" *************************************************************************** Selphy ES2/20: Init func: 40 00 [pgcode] 00 02 00 00 [type] 00 00 00 [pg2] [length, 32-bit LE] Plane func: 40 01 [plane] 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 Type codes are 0x00 for Color papers, 0x01 for B&W papers. Plane codes are 0x01, 0x02, 0x03 for Y, M, and C, respectively. B&W Jobs have a single plane code of 0x01. 'P' papers pgcode of 0x01 and a plane length of 2227456 bytes 'CP_L' pgcode of 0x02 and a plane length of 1601600 bytes. 'Card' pgcode of 0x03 and a plane length of 698880 bytes. pg2 is 0x00 for all media types except for 'Card', which is 0x01. Plane codes are 0x01, 0x02, 0x03 for Y, M, and C, respectively. B&W Jobs have a single plane code of 0x01. 'P' papers pgcode of 0x00 and a plane length of 2227456 bytes. 'CP_L' pgcode of 0x01 and a plane length of 1601600 bytes. 'Card' pgcode of 0x02 and a plane length of 698880 bytes. Readback codes are unknown. *************************************************************************** Selphy CP790: Init func: 40 00 [pgcode] 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 [length, 32-bit LE] Plane func: 40 01 [plane] 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 End func: 40 20 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 Plane codes are 0x01, 0x02, 0x03 for Y, M, and C, respectively. B&W Jobs have a single plane code of 0x01. 'P' papers pgcode of 0x00 and a plane length of 2227456 bytes. 'CP_L' pgcode of 0x01 and a plane length of 1601600 bytes. 'Card' pgcode of 0x02 and a plane length of 698880 bytes. 'Wide' pgcode of 0x03 and a plane length of 2976512 bytes. Readback codes are unknown. *************************************************************************** Selphy CP-series (except for CP-790, CP-810, CP-900): Init func: 40 00 00 [pgcode] 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 00 Plane func: 40 01 00 [plane] [length, 32-bit LE] 00 00 00 00 plane codes are 0x00, 0x01, 0x02 for Y, M, and C, respectively. 'P' paper pgcode 0x01 plane length 2227456 bytes. 'CP_L' pgcode 0x02 plane length 1601600 bytes. 'Card' paper pgcode 0x03 plane length 698880 bytes. 'Wide' paper pgcode 0x04 plane length 2976512 bytes.
